The Twizy's Battery: A Look at Lifespan and Care

When it arrives to the Renault Twizy, its battery plays a crucial role. This electric vehicle relies on its battery for power, so understanding its lifespan and proper maintenance techniques is vital for owners.

The Twizy's lithium-ion battery typically boasts a range of up to 100 kilometers on a single charge, but this can vary depending on factors like driving style, temperature, and terrain.

To optimize the battery's lifespan, drivers should adopt certain {practices|. This includes avoiding deep discharges, keeping the battery topped up when not in use, and charging it at a moderate rate.

  • Regularly inspecting the battery for any signs of damage or wear is also advised.
  • It's crucial to consult your Twizy owner's manual for precise instructions on battery care and maintenance.

Quadricycle Electrique vs Gasoline: Environmental Impact

The comparison of a quadricycle run on batteries versus one powered by gasoline reveals stark differences in their environmental impact. Electric quadricycles, operating solely on electricity, produce zero tailpipe emissions, thus minimizing air pollution linked with fossil fuels. In contrast, gasoline-powered quadricycles emit harmful greenhouse gases and pollutants, worsening climate change and affecting air quality.

  • However, the production of electric quadricycles involves the mining and processing of raw materials, which associated with their own environmental challenges. Gasoline-powered quadricycles depend on fossil fuels, a non-renewable resource mined through environmentally detrimental practices.
  • Ultimately, the environmental impact of a quadricycle varies on various aspects. Electric quadricycles offer significant strengths in terms of emissions reduction, but their production systems also have environmental consequences. Gasoline-powered quadricycles continue to pose a significant threat to the environment due to greenhouse gas emissions and resource depletion.

Understanding Electric Quadricycle Battery Technology

Electric quadricycles are becoming increasingly popular as a sustainable and practical mode of transportation. A crucial aspect of their performance and range lies in the battery technology employed. These batteries commonly utilize lithium-ion chemistry, known for its high energy density. They are designed to withstand the rigorous demands of quadricycle operation, providing a reliable and consistent power supply.

  • Additionally, advancements in battery management systems (BMS) are constantly being made to optimize charging cycles, extend battery life, and enhance overall safety.
  • Innovation into new battery chemistries, such as solid-state batteries, holds opportunity for even greater energy storage capacity and performance in future electric quadricycles.
